Abstract
Pre-anesthesia blood pressure (BP) elevation frequently occurs in normotensive elective surgical patients and may disrupt perioperative safety. This study adopted two mainstream diagnostic criteria (absolute and relative thresholds) to define BP elevation, and integrated physical, laboratory and psychological indicators to systematically explore relevant associated factors.
This case-control study enrolling a total of 528 non-cardiac surgical patients. Patients were divided into case (elevated pre-anesthesia BP) and control (normal pre-anesthesia BP) groups. Pre-anesthesia BP elevation was defined as absolute threshold (systolic BP [SBP] ≥140 mmHg and/or diastolic BP [DBP] ≥90 mmHg), and relative threshold (≥20% increase from baseline). Multivariable logistic regression was used to screen associated factors.
The incidence of pre-anesthesia BP elevation was 35.6% (n=188) under the absolute threshold and 28.2% (n=149) under the relative threshold. Multivariable analysis revealed that increasing age (absolute threshold: odds ratio [OR] 1.08, 95% confidence interval [CI] 1.05-1.10, relative threshold: OR 1.03, 95% CI 1.01-1.04), hyperlipemia (absolute threshold: OR 2.66, 95% CI 1.84-3.86, relative threshold: OR 1.49, 95% CI 1.18-1.88) and anxiety (absolute threshold: OR 1.17, 95% CI 1.10-1.25, relative threshold: OR 1.07, 95% CI 1.02-1.13) were correlated with BP elevation under both definitions (all p < 0.01). Under the absolute threshold, body mass index (BMI) (OR 1.12, 95% CI 1.03-1.21) and alcohol drinking (OR 2.74, 95% CI 1.55-4.84) were positively correlated (both p < 0.01), whereas prolonged sleep duration (2-4 hours: OR 0.37, 95% CI 0.15-0.95, 4-6 hours: OR 0.14, 95% CI 0.06-0.35, 6-8 hours: OR 0.12, 95% CI 0.04-0.34) was negatively correlated (all p < 0.05).
Increasing age, hyperlipemia and preoperative anxiety are consistently associated with transient pre-anesthesia BP elevation under both criteria. Further studies are required to confirm causal links and verify whether intervening on these correlates can reduce perioperative BP fluctuations.
